Just wondering if anyone has any info about mounting systems designed for barrel roofs.  I have been looking into this for a little while and can't seem to find any commercially available mounting solution to this roof type.  Has anyone else had any experience mounting to this roof type?  My first thought was to create some kind of raised flat structure to mount to using unistrut and standoffs and maybe a top down mounting system on top of it?  Any ideas?
